Ballybacon Grange have lost out against Waterford’s Ardmore in today’s Munster Junior A Hurling final.
Ardmore were down to 13 men by half time – Jack Walsh and Wayne Hennessey sent off there, and they lost a third man in the second half
However the Waterford side still managed to push on to win comfortably – it finished 3-11 to 2-08
